The SN74CBT3257CPW is a high-performance integrated circuit designed by Texas Instruments, a leader in semiconductor solutions. This device is a 4-bit 1-of-2 FET multiplexer/demultiplexer that is characterized for operation from -40°C to 85°C, making it suitable for a wide range of applications in various industries.
Key Features
- Low Power Consumption: This device is designed to consume minimal power, making it ideal for battery-powered and energy-sensitive applications.
- High Speed: The SN74CBT3257CPW offers a quick switching capability, allowing for high-speed data transmission and signal routing.
- Wide Operating Temperature Range: With a temperature range of -40°C to 85°C, this device can reliably operate in extreme conditions.
- Low On-State Resistance: The device features a low on-state resistance, which minimizes signal distortion and ensures efficient signal transmission.
- 5-V Tolerant Inputs: The inputs can tolerate up to 5V, making the device compatible with various logic levels and protecting it from potential damage caused by over-voltage.

Product Specifications
The SN74CBT3257CPW comes in a TSSOP (Thin Shrink Small Outline Package) with 16 pins, providing a compact footprint for space-constrained applications. It is designed using Texas Instruments' BiCMOS technology, which combines the high speed of Bipolar with the low power of CMOS, ensuring both performance and efficiency.
